Pearl City won against Durand/Pecatonica on Tuesday with 15 runs and they decided to stick to that run total again on Thursday. The Wolves were the clear victors by a 15-1 margin over the Rivermen. The result was nothing new for the Wolves, who have now won six contests by seven runs or more so far this season.
Brandon Hillie made a big impact no matter where he played. He looked comfortable on the mound, not allowing a single earned run while striking out seven over four innings pitched. He has been nothing but reliable: he hasn't given up more than one earned run in eight consecutive appearances. He was also stellar in the batter's box, going 2-for-3 with four RBI, one run, and one double. Those four RBI gave him a new career-high.
In other batting news, Kip Martens was incredible, going 2-for-3 with three runs, one triple, and one double. He is becoming a predictor of Pearl City's success: when he posts at least two runs the team is 4-1 (and 4-6 when he doesn't). The team also got some help courtesy of Jacob Runkle, who went 1-for-2 with two runs, one stolen base, and one RBI.
Pearl City was getting hits left and right and finished the game having posted a batting average of .435. They are a perfect 6-0 when they post a batting average of .375 or better.
The win (which was Pearl City's third in a row) raised their record to 8-7. The vict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 3.0 runs on average over those games. As for Durand/Pecatonica, their defeat was their fourth straight on the road, which dropped their record down to 2-14.
